We're exclusively supporting a leading, fast-growing regional law firm as they look to appoint an experienced HR Officer. This is a fantastic opportunity for an organised and proactive HR professional who enjoys variety, thrives in a people-centric environment, and is confident working with stakeholders at all levels. Our client is known for their down-to-earth culture, strong values, and high-quality legal services. With continued growth across the firm, they're strengthening their HR function to ensure their internal processes keep pace with the success of the business.

What You'll Be Doing

  • Coordinating and enhancing the appraisal process
  • Organising and supporting training and development programmes
  • Providing first-line HR advice to managers on policies and employee relations
  • Assisting with disciplinary investigations and preparing relevant documentation
  • Managing internal communications and engagement initiatives
  • Supporting recruitment and onboarding activity
  • Providing administrative support to the Health, Safety and Wellbeing team

What We're Looking For

  • Minimum of 3 years' HR experience
  • CIPD Level 5 (or working towards) preferred
  • Strong working knowledge of core HR processes (ER, recruitment, training, appraisals)
  • Excellent communication and relationship-building skills
  • Professional, discreet, and comfortable handling sensitive matters
  • Highly organised with strong attention to detail
  • Competent with Microsoft Office and able to pick up new systems quickly
  • Full UK driving licence
